Output 59d22c81744d09395d4cee997485e27cfb0b7fe3698810e9d37f3057478fea8b:0

value
345393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639d29fc70aae2eb2c2e472d9f444a810c3da9f2 OP_EQUAL
address
3Amj6Utfnq9gB43kbVWGc29pjgJTPJ4Wvi
transaction
59d22c81744d09395d4cee997485e27cfb0b7fe3698810e9d37f3057478fea8b
confirmations
70352
spent
true